PyTorch深度学习(14)命令行记录及安装梳理

43 篇文章 17 订阅
34 篇文章 7 订阅

下载anaconda,并安装
在Anaconda目录中,打开Anaconda Prompt

分别输入python    及    conda
进入anaconda安装文件夹,同时按住shift和右键,打开Powershell窗口
输入jupyter notebook,如打不开,则需要复制 or copy and paste one of these URLs下的网址链接
new——> Python3    shift+enter键可运行代码


安装pytorch环境
conda create -n pytorch python=3.8


安装环境后,切换环境
conda activate pytorch
查看环境中的包列表
pip list


pytorch官网
https://pytorch.org/
NV显卡支持cuda
https://www.geforce.cn/hardware/technology/cuda/supported-gpus


cmd——>nvidia-smi  查看驱动是否满足(需要终端以 管理员身份运行)  查看显卡驱动中的CUDA版本


1、首先是添加清华镜像channel
2、安装的指令,主要是把官网指令后面的-c pytorch删掉,-c pytorch的意思是,
安装下载的channel强制为pytorch官网的channel。所以需要删除才能走清华镜像的channel


清华源安装
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/
con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main/
conda config --set show_channel_urls yes

# reference
# https://mirror.tuna.tsinghua.edu.cn/help/anaconda/

con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ud/pytorch/

conda config --remove-key channels    恢复Anaconda源为默认


最后执行安装pytorch的命令即可  安装pytorch命令行
conda install pytorch torchvision torchaudio cudatoolkit=11.1 -c pytorch -c conda-forge

conda install pytorch==1.8.0 torchvision==0.9.0 torchaudio==0.8.0 cudatoolkit=11.1 -c pytorch -c conda-forge
执行上方命令后即安装了torch,不需要再次安装


安装成功后运行python,进入python命令台
输入import torch,如果出现缺少包的情况,则pip install xxx   例如:pip install numpy

torch.cuda.is_available()——>输出:true    cude安装成功

Python文件:代码以块为一个整体运行,Python文件的块是所有行的代码
优点:通用,传播方便,适用于大型项目
缺点:需要从头运行
Python控制台:以任意行为块运行
优:显示每个变量属性  缺:不利于代码阅读及修改
Jupyter:以任意行为块进行
优:利于代码阅读及修改  缺:环境需要配置


pip install opencv-python    安装cv2包

pip install tensorboard        安装tensorboard (x轴步长,y轴值)
tensorboard --logdir=logs  事件文件所在文件夹名称
tensorboard --logdir=logs --port=6007  修改端口为6007


Settings——Editor——General——Code Completion代码补全——Match case匹配大小写

Ctrl + O  重写方法    ctrl+l 实现方法

创建环境
conda create -n pytorch python=3.8        

conda update -n base -c defaults conda    更新conda

查看conda中环境
conda env list    conda环境列表
conda info --envs    查看环境
conda remove --name env_name --all  删除环境
conda remove --name env_name package_name  删除环境中某个包
conda deactivate 环境名    关闭环境

python -m pip install --upgrade pip    更新pip

python --version  查看python版本

pip install -U numpy    升级numpy

安装tensorflow GPU版本(使用源下载速度更快)
pip install tensorflow-gpu -i https://pypi.doubanio.com/simple  默认安装的是2.6.0版本

pip uninstall tensorflow tensorflow-gpu    卸载tensorflow
pip install tensorflow-gpu==2.4.0 -i https://pypi.doubanio.com/simple


使用 PyTorch 查看 CUDA 和 cuDNN 版本
import torch
print(torch.__version__)
print(torch.version.cuda)
print(torch.backends.cudnn.version())

cmd中
where python     python的存放目录
where ipython    python交互工具
where pip               pip的位置目录

 

win+R  %HOMEPATH%  调出电脑主文件夹

  • 1
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值